When I think of Cuba, several products come to mind. Music. Cigars. Rum. Nuclear missiles. But not, curiously, coffee. Historically, Cuba was a big coffee producer; in the 1950s, exports were exceeding 20,000 tons. Chocolate and beer have a long history together. I confess that when I wrote that statement, I was thinking of the long history of chocolate stouts.
